Hull and Outfitting

Rectangular Components - Stiffening

The task of creating an HVAC Component is initiated from the HVAC Window.

  1. Select Rectangular in the Categories dropdown list and then Stiffening in the Available Type dropdown list to display the Stiffening window:

    You are required to input the following dimensions:

    • Stiffener width

    • Stiffener depth

    • Duct width LA

    • Duct depth LB

    • Spec Requirement

    • Number of Sides

    • Face from Leave

    • A offset

    • B offset

    • Angle

    • Stiffener Face

    • Other Web

    • Web Thickness

  2. To visualize how the dimensions equate to the actual piece of HVAC, select Picture to display a detailed drawing for Rectangular Components Catalog Element - Stiffener.

    Note: The fields will be pre-populated with default dimensions. These dimensions are governed by the details defined in the HVAC Catalog.

    The application has automatically calculated the required number of stiffeners to support the CE (using the current detailing specification and other parameters). The number is displayed in the Spec Requirement box.

    The number of sides of the CE is automatically input into the Number of Sides box, in this case as the CE is a rectangular straight the number of sides is input as 4.

    Note: Stiffening flanges are configured to suit each different component.

  3. Select OK the Spec Requirement to confirm the automatically generated number of stiffeners is compatible with the detailing specification.

  4. If this is not required, click Q Spec Req, to change the automatically generated number of stiffeners.

  5. After selecting the Spec Requirement the user must enter the Aoff Direction.

  6. In the Aoff Direction enter the direction for the Aoffset relative to the Point of Origin. Valid directions areX, Y, Z, -X, -Y or -Z.

  7. In the Connect list, select Connect or Unchanged:

    • Select Connect (default when Create is selected) - connects the piece of HVAC to the previous one.

    • Select Unchanged (default when Modify is selected) - positions the component at the co-ordinates 0.00.

    Note: Unchanged is usually used, when Modify is selected, it does not connect the component but positions it at 0.00, in effect in a floating position.

  8. Select Defaults to reset all the fields back to when the Stiffening window was opened.

  9. Select OK to create the Stiffening Flanges and close the Stiffening window. You will be returned to the HVAC Window.

  10. Select Cancel to discard all field changes and close the Stiffening window.
